Definitions:

Operant Conditioning

A learning process where the strength of a behavior is modified by reinforcement or punishment.

Observational Conditioning

A learning process where an individual acquires behaviors by observing and imitating others.

State-Dependent Learning

The theory that information learned in a specific state of mind (e.g., emotional, physiological) is more easily recalled when in that same state.

Conditioned Stimulus

An initially neutral signal that, once linked with an unconditioned stimulus, ultimately elicits a conditioned response.
